Condition & Use:
– Since it’s a used rod, inspect for:
– Cane integrity (checks, cracks, or delamination).
– Ferrules (tight fit, no wobbling).
– Varnish condition (chips or wear?).
– Guide wraps (loose threads or corrosion?).
– Originality (any replaced parts?).
